Dementia is a neurodegenerative disorder that presents in multiple forms with varying symptoms and causes. While no cure currently exists, ongoing scientific research continues to explore potential treatments and preventive strategies.

This condition is marked by progressive cognitive decline, affecting memory, reasoning, language skills, judgment, and behavior. It can result from various diseases or injuries and ranges from mild impairment to severe disability, sometimes altering personality. While some forms are progressive and irreversible, others may be treatable or even reversible. Some medical professionals restrict the term “dementia” to describe only irreversible cognitive deterioration.

Dementia symptoms

Early indicators of dementia may include:

  1. Resistance to routine or environmental changes
  2. Short-term memory difficulties contrasting with preserved long-term memories
  3. Word-finding challenges during conversations
  4. Repetitive behaviors or questioning
  5. Disorientation in familiar settings
  6. Difficulty following conversations or narratives
  7. Mood fluctuations including depression or irritability
  8. Loss of interest in previously enjoyed activities
  9. General confusion about people, places, or events
  10. Challenges performing routine daily activities

Underlying causes

Dementia results from neuronal degeneration or systemic disruptions affecting neural function. Primary causes include Alzheimer’s disease and vascular dementia, with other contributing factors being:

Neurodegenerative conditions

These progressive disorders involve gradual neuronal deterioration, disrupting critical brain communication pathways. Major examples include Alzheimer’s, Parkinson’s-related dementia, vascular dementia, and alcohol-induced cognitive decline. Frontotemporal lobar degeneration, affecting specific brain regions, encompasses conditions like frontotemporal dementia and Pick’s disease.

Additional causative factors

Other contributors include structural brain abnormalities (e.g., hydrocephalus, hematomas), metabolic disorders (thyroid dysfunction, B12 deficiency), toxic exposures (heavy metals), certain tumors, infections, and medication effects. Some reversible forms exist when identified early, emphasizing the importance of prompt medical evaluation.

Dementia classifications

Major dementia types include Alzheimer’s (60-80% of cases), vascular dementia (impaired blood flow), Lewy body dementia (protein deposits), Parkinson’s-related dementia, and frontotemporal dementia (language/behavior focus). Rare forms like Creutzfeldt-Jakob disease affect approximately 1 in 1 million individuals.

Progression stages

Dementia progression varies individually but typically follows recognizable stages:

Mild cognitive impairment

Characterized by memory lapses and word recall difficulties, though not all cases progress to dementia.

Early-stage dementia

Individuals maintain independence while experiencing memory issues, personality changes, and task-completion challenges.

Moderate dementia

Requiring caregiver assistance, symptoms include significant memory loss, confusion, and personal care difficulties.

Advanced dementia

Marked by physical decline, loss of bodily functions, communication impairment, and increased infection risk. Note that progression rates vary significantly.

Diagnostic procedures

Diagnosis involves comprehensive evaluation including medical history, physical exams, and laboratory tests. While dementia symptoms can be identified, determining specific types may require specialist consultation due to symptom overlap.

Treatment approaches

Current treatments focus on symptom management rather than cure, utilizing both pharmacological and non-pharmacological interventions.

Pharmacological options

Two primary medication classes:

  1. Cholinesterase inhibitors: Enhance memory-related neurotransmitters, potentially slowing Alzheimer’s progression
  2. Memantine: Preserves cognitive function in moderate-severe cases, sometimes combined with other medications

Aducanumab (Aduhelm)

This recently approved intravenous therapy targets amyloid proteins in Alzheimer’s, with ongoing research evaluating its efficacy.

Non-pharmacological interventions

Supportive strategies include:

  1. Environmental adjustments to reduce distractions
  2. Task simplification techniques
  3. Occupational therapy for daily activity adaptation

Preventive measures

Emerging evidence suggests lifestyle factors (hypertension, obesity, social isolation) influence dementia risk. Adopting healthy habits including regular exercise and balanced nutrition may help mitigate risk.

Life expectancy

Advanced dementia is considered terminal, with survival times varying widely based on age, gender, and overall health status. Certain factors may correlate with shorter life expectancy, though progression remains unpredictable.

Dementia vs. Alzheimer’s

Dementia is an umbrella term for cognitive decline symptoms, while Alzheimer’s represents the most prevalent specific form. Key distinctions include Alzheimer’s characteristic memory loss patterns and specific pathological changes. Treatment approaches vary by dementia type, with some forms potentially reversible when addressing underlying causes.

Alcohol-related dementia

Alcohol misuse significantly elevates dementia risk, particularly early-onset cases. Studies indicate alcohol use disorders may triple dementia likelihood, though moderate consumption may offer cardiovascular benefits without substantial cognitive risk.

Normal aging vs. dementia

While occasional forgetfulness occurs with normal aging, persistent memory impairment affecting daily function warrants medical evaluation. Warning signs include forgetting familiar people or routine tasks.

Epidemiology

WHO estimates indicate approximately 55 million global dementia cases, with 10 million new annual diagnoses. Aging populations suggest rising prevalence, with US senior numbers projected to nearly double by 2030.

Current research

Ongoing investigations explore diverse avenues including:

– Repurposed medications (e.g., asthma drug zileuton for Alzheimer’s)
– Deep brain stimulation techniques
– Early detection blood tests
– Genetic, inflammatory, and oxidative stress factors
– Lifestyle interventions (exercise, social engagement)

Prognosis

Alzheimer’s ranks as the seventh leading US cause of death (CDC). While disease trajectories vary, early diagnosis facilitates better planning. Current research continues to advance understanding and treatment possibilities.
